This chicken fried rice is a classic flavor that you can get from a Chinese takeout restaurant. Itis easy to make, and it's absolutely delicious. So, if you don't know what to cook for dinner, this is it!
Ingredients
Marinade the Chicken
-
250 grams of chicken breast
- 1 tsp of cornstarch
-
1 tsp of soy sauce
- 1 tsp of vegetable oil
- 1/8 tsp of baking soda
To Season the Fried Rice
- 2 cups of leftover rice
-
1 tbsp of light soy sauce
-
2 tsp of dark soy sauce
-
1/2 tsp of chicken bouillon powder
-
Ground black pepper to taste
To Complete the Fried Rice
- 2 eggs
-
2 tbsp oil to fry the egg
-
1.5 tbsp oil to stir fry the chicken
- 1 tbsp of minced garlic
- 1/3 cup of red onion, diced
- 1/3 cup of peas, diced
- 1/3 cup of carrot, diced
- 3 tbsp of spring onion, diced
Directions
Preparation Before Cooking
Roughly cut the chicken breast into bite-sized pieces, then marinate it with cornstarch, soy sauce, vegetable oil, and baking soda. Set it aside.
If the rice is in big chunks, crumble it into loose grains for even cooking.
Season the rice with light soy sauce, dark soy sauce, and black pepper powder to taste.
- Dice the carrot, green beans, onion, and scallion; Mince the garlic.
- Crack two eggs and whisk well.
Cook the Fried Rice
Heat the wok to smoking hot. Add 2 tbsp of oil and stir the egg until set, which will take less than a minute. Break the egg into bite-sized pieces and remove it from the wok.
Add 1.5 tbsp of oil to the same wok and stir the marinated chicken over high heat for a minute or 2.
Add garlic, carrot, green beans, and onion. Stir over medium heat for a few minutes or until the vegetables are soft.
Add the rice and stir over high heat for a few minutes or until you can smell the toasty rice aroma.
Introduce the egg back to the wok. Sprinkle some scallions for extra flavor and mix until everything is well combined.
